public OrderController(ILogger <OrderController> logger, IOrderRepository orderRepository, IMapper mapper, IStaffProductFacade staffProductFacade, IInvoiceFacade invoiceFacade, IReviewFacade reviewFacade) { _logger = logger; _orderRepository = orderRepository; _mapper = mapper; _staffProductFacade = staffProductFacade; _invoiceFacade = invoiceFacade; _reviewFacade = reviewFacade; }
private void DefaultSetupRealHttpClient(HttpStatusCode statusCode) { SetupStockReductions(); var expectedResult = new HttpResponseMessage { StatusCode = statusCode }; SetMockMessageHandler(expectedResult); SetupRealHttpClient(expectedResult); SetupHttpFactoryMock(client); SetupConfig(); SetupHttpHandlerMock(); facade = new StaffProductFacade(config, mockHttpHandler.Object); SetupConfig(); }